I bought small head, self drilling deck screws to use instead of nails to replace some cedar siding on the house. They have the spline drive and claim they are hardened to eliminate stripping. Another chinesium lie. They do go thru the cedar easily, but once they hit the OSB, they want to strip before they make it to the 2x4. I ended up pre-drilling 100 friggen holes to use this crap.
